When it comes to buying insurance for your electric surfboard, there are a few coverage options to consider. The most basic type of coverage is liability insurance, which covers you in case you cause damage to someone else’s property or injure someone while using your electric surfboard. This is a must-have coverage, as accidents can happen, and you don’t want to be on the hook for expensive medical bills or property damage.
Another important coverage option to consider is comprehensive insurance, which covers you in case your electric surfboard is stolen or damaged in a non-collision incident, such as a fire or vandalism. This type of coverage can be a lifesaver if your electric surfboard is stolen or damaged, as it can be expensive to repair or replace.
Collision insurance is another coverage option to consider, which covers you in case your electric surfboard is damaged in a collision with another object, such as a boat or a dock. This type of coverage can be especially important if you plan on using your electric surfboard in crowded or high-traffic areas, where the risk of collisions is higher.
Finally, you may also want to consider adding personal injury protection to your electric surfboard insurance policy. This coverage can help cover medical expenses and lost wages in case you are injured while using your electric surfboard. While this coverage is not required, it can provide valuable financial protection in case of an accident.

Another way to save money on electric surfboard insurance is to consider raising your deductible. The deductible is the amount of money you have to pay out of pocket before your insurance coverage kicks in. By choosing a higher deductible, you can lower your monthly premiums. Just make sure that you have enough money set aside to cover the deductible in case you need to make a claim.
